What is an Island Chimney Hood?

An cooker island Hood chimney hood is a kind of kitchen ventilation system that is installed above an island cooker hood cooking area. Unlike traditional wall-mounted hoods, which are generally placed over a wall-mounted range, island chimney hoods are suspended from the ceiling. Their design frequently resembles a big canopy, offering both functional ventilation and striking looks.

Setup Process

Steps for Installing an Island Chimney Hood

  1. Evaluate Your Kitchen Layout: Determine the best place for installing the hood based on the cooking surface's height and your kitchen's design.

  2. Select the Right Hood: Choose a design that fits your cooking practices, kitchen size, and visual choices.

  3. Gather Necessary Tools: Gather tools such as a drill, screwdriver, level, measuring tape, and potentially a ladder for reaching higher ceilings.

  4. Attaching the Mounting Bracket: Follow the producer's standards to attach the installing bracket securely to the ceiling, ensuring it is level.

  5. Set Up the Exhaust Duct (if relevant): If utilizing a ducted model, link the exhaust duct, ensuring it runs directly to the outside to prevent any air flow problems.

  6. Connect the Hood: Secure the hood to the mounted bracket and make the electrical connections according to the manufacturer's guidelines.

  7. Check the System: Ensure the island chimney hood runs correctly, evaluating the various settings and making sure the lighting is functional.

Safety Considerations

  • Electrical Safety: Ensure that all electrical connections abide by local codes and are securely insulated.
  • Weight Distribution: Confirm that the ceiling structure can support the weight of the hood.
  • Proper Ventilation: If ducted, ensure that the vent leads outside for optimum air flow.

3. What is the difference between ducted and ductless island chimney hoods?

Ducted hoods vent air outside, while ductless hoods filter and recirculate air within the kitchen. Ducted hoods are normally more effective in eliminating odors and pollutants.

4. How do I determine the right size for an island chimney hood?

The size of the hood ought to be at least as large as the cooktop, with recommendations normally suggesting a minimum of 24 inches of clearance from the cooking surface for optimum efficiency.
